The Zachtronics Solitaire Collection

The Zachtronics Solitaire Collection delivers exactly what it promises in the name, with eight polished and very addictive variations of solitaire. Seven of these titles were originally launched as mini-games for Zachtronics titles released between 2016 and 2022, but the collection also includes one new variation. The convenience of having all these titles as part of one collection is excellent, and the updated 4K graphics are also a big plus. While solitaire fans will have a blast with this collection, it is also accessible enough to appeal to new players looking for a way to kill some time.

Pretty Girls Speed First Look Video

Pretty Girls Speed by Zoo Corporation is an easy to play and fast-paced game that requires quick judgment and skill. The game’s goal is to lose all the cards in your hand before your opponent does. This is done by connecting them sequentially to the cards on the table, but you have to be quick as your opponent is trying to do the same. Pretty Girls Speed features a Battle Mode with ten opponents to play against as well as a 100 level Challenge Mode to conquer. Check out the video below to see both modes in action

Card Hog (SnoutUp)

Card Hog by SnoutUp is a card-based dungeon crawler where you pick your little pig protagonist and then try to stay alive for as long as possible. Along the way, you get to slay all manner of foes and pick up different weapons with which to do the slaying. You’ll also want to keep an eye on your health and grab the healing potions needed to keep the porky protagonist alive. All in all, it plays like a typical role-playing game but presented in the most accessible way possible

Jewel Match Twilight Solitaire

Jewel Match Twilight Solitaire is a polished solitaire title with a vampire theme. While it doesn’t feature a gripping storyline or much in the way of gimmicks, it does have plenty of levels, a lot of obstacles to overcome and some nifty power-ups to help you out. Three difficulty levels mean that the game can be as easy or challenging as you want it to be and it even includes a bunch of mahjong levels for variation. This is definitely a great game for fans of the genre and one that can keep you busy for quite some time if you are a perfectionist.

Gameplay: Two hundred levels of solitaire fun along with 50 optional mahjong levels.

Shadowhand: RPG Card Game

Shadowhand is another entertaining, addictive, and polished solitaire-based game from Grey Alien Games, creators of the very enjoyable Regency Solitaire. It shares some similarities with its predecessor, but the story is brand new, and the gameplay offers enough new additions and tweaks to ensure that it feels fresh. Luck plays a significant role in the game, which is unavoidable for the genre, but careful planning and using the right items can help a lot. This means the game is much more strategic than you might think, and we can heartily recommend it to fans of the genre.

Concrete Jungle

Concrete Jungle offers an interesting mix of genres that all combine to provide a compelling gameplay experience that is also much more challenging than you would think. In the versus modes, city planning turns into a vicious game of sabotage and dirty tricks, while the solo mode requires players to think ahead in order to survive. Multi-player is, unfortunately, local only, but even so, this game will keep players busy for ages.
